Why Are Audi Keys So Expensive?
The primary factor for the high expense of Audi secrets depends on security. Modern Audis utilize an immobilizer system that recognizes the specific chip inside a key fob. If the car does not recognize the unique digital signature, the engine will not start. This prevents "hot-wiring" and other standard methods of car theft.
Additionally, most modern Audi designs use "Advanced Key" technology, which permits keyless entry and push-to-start functionality. These fobs utilize rolling codes for encryption, implying the code modifications whenever the button is pushed. Setting these codes needs specialized proprietary software application frequently restricted to licensed dealers or high-end automotive locksmiths.

Audi owners normally have 3 opportunities for acquiring an extra key. Each has its own set of benefits and drawbacks.
1. The Audi Dealership
The car dealership is the most protected and reliable choice. They order the key specifically for the lorry's V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) from the factory in Germany.
Pros: Guaranteed to work; VIN-specific; OEM quality.Cons: Most costly; needs an appointment; you should often tow the car to the dealership.2. Expert Automotive Locksmiths
A specialized locksmith professional with VAG-group (Volkswagen Audi Group) diagnostic tools can typically perform the very same service as a dealer.
Pros: Usually 20-30% cheaper; lots of provide mobile services (they pertain to you); faster turn-around.Cons: Not all locksmiths have the pricey equipment required for more recent Audi "MQB" platform secrets.3. Online/Aftermarket Purchases

The length of time does it take to get an extra key?
If a locksmith has the blank in stock, it can be carried out in under an hour. If the car dealership needs to order the key from Germany, it can take anywhere from 3 to 10 business days.
What if I purchased an Audi that only included one key?
Value-wise, it is extremely advised to negotiate the cost of a second key into the purchase price of the car. If already acquired, it is smart to get an extra instantly to avoid the ₤ 1,000+ "all keys lost" circumstance.
Will an utilized key from another Audi work?
Usually, no. The majority of Audi keys are "locked" to the VIN of the first car they were configured to. While some top-level locksmiths can "unlock" specific fobs, it is often more expensive than purchasing a new one.
Does the battery impacts shows?
If your key quiting working, always try changing the CR2032 or CR2025 battery first. A dead battery does not suggest the key requirements to be replaced or reprogrammed; it generally just needs a fresh ₤ 5 power cell.
